Klaas Puul to build new shrimp processing plant
(NETHERLANDS, 1/31/2017)
The board of directors of the producer and supplier of fishery products, Klaas Puul B.V., plans to build a shrimp processing plant in Volendam.
The company's executives made the decision mainly due to the ever increasing hygienic requirements and the need to adhere to the highest BRC certification standards.
According to the company, the new factory will have a surface of 5,506 m2, where the packing lines will be installed.
The current thawing and cooking facilities will be moved to Edam, in northwest Netherlands, adding another 2.000 m2 to this factory.
Although the idea for these construction plans where already present in 2012, the need of a new factory in Tangier (Morocco) force the company to postpone Volendam plans.
Under various white labels, Klaas Puul supplies almost all major retail organizations in the Netherlands, France, Belgium, Germany and other countries. In addition to a wide range of shrimp and prawn, it also supplies other types of fish (frozen).
Klaas Puul expects to open the new headquarters in Volendam next year, when the firm will celebrate its 50th birthday.
